- Sarra Cottage is believed to originally date back to around 1740.

A Grade 2 listed detached building, it has a thatched roof and is built in the traditional Lincolnshire ‘Mud & Stud’ construction..The cottage is a quaint mixture of old and new. The original cottage has low beams and narrow doors while the more modern extensions house a kitchen, bathroom and conservatory.
Bed Room 2 has an en-suite toilet and wash hand basin. It is accessible from the rear garden; there is no access from the main cottage building.
Built on 1 level there are some steps between the rooms.
The cottage has gas fired central heating throughout. This also heats the hot water. There is a back-up electric hot water immersion heater.
Naked flames are not compatible with a thatched roof so please, no smoking, no candles and no BBQs.
